Willard Rouse Jillson (May 28, 1890 – October 4, 1975) was a Kentucky historian academic, and geologist who authored numerous books on Kentucky politicians and geology matters pertaining to the State. Jillson taught geology in Lexington at the University of Kentucky in 1918 and later at Transylvania University in 1947. He served in various government positions, notably as Kentucky State Geologist and director of the Sixth Kentucky Geological Survey. He died in 1975 and was buried in the Frankfort Cemetery in Frankfort, Kentucky.

The Willard Rouse Jillson Geology of the Mintonville Dome collection contains the proofs and rough draft typescript of this book. The proofs and typescript are annotated by the author. The book was printed by the Roberts Printing Company in Frankfort Kentucky, 1962. This book discusses the location of the Dome, the field work done while at the Dome, and other geological surveying done of the Dome.
